About Ling Chen
Ling Chen is a scholar working on Food Science, Nutrition and Dietetics, Biomaterials, Molecular Biology and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 852 papers that have together received 30.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Food composition and properties (143 papers), bi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(82 papers), Polysaccharides Composition and Applications (81 papers), Proteins in Food Systems (65 papers), Nanocomposite Films for Food Packaging (63 papers), Microbial Metabolites in Food Biotechnology (43 papers), Advanced Cellulose Research Studies (30 papers)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(29 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nutrition and Dietetics (8.8k citations), Biomaterials (7.6k citations), Food Science (7.7k citations), Molecular Medicine (989 citations) and Pollution (2.0k citations). Ling Chen has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Xiaoxi Li, Fengwei Xie, Long Yu, Bo Zheng, Hongsheng Liu, Binjia Zhang, Lin Li, Chengdeng Chi, Xingxun Liu and Long Yu. Their work appears in journals such as Carbohydrate Polymers, Food Hydrocolloids, International Journal of Biological Macromolecules, Food Chemistry and Frontiers in Microbiology.
